Wangerooge

Wangerooge is a unique island destination within Friesland, offering an unparalleled escape to nature and tranquility. As one of the East Frisian Islands, it’s a car-free retreat, accessible only by ferry, which adds to its secluded and peaceful charm. This makes it suited to travellers who want a complete break from the hustle and bustle, particularly those who appreciate pristine natural environments and a slower pace of life. The Lagoon on the Wadden See vacation rental highlights the island's connection to its stunning natural surroundings.

Life on Wangerooge revolves around its natural beauty. Visitors can enjoy long walks on the beach, explore the unique Wadden Sea ecosystem, and simply relax in the fresh sea air. The island offers a range of activities, from birdwatching to cycling. Reaching Wangerooge involves travelling to the mainland port and then taking a ferry, a journey that itself is part of the island experience. It’s a perfect destination for nature lovers and those seeking a truly serene getaway in Friesland.

What to Eat and Where to Find It in Friesland

Friesland's culinary landscape is deeply rooted in its coastal location and agricultural heritage, offering a distinct flavour profile that sets it apart within Germany. Visitors can expect hearty, traditional dishes that emphasize fresh, local ingredients. Seafood plays a prominent role, with specialties like smoked fish and various preparations of North Sea catches being a must-try. Beyond the coast, the region's farms provide excellent dairy products, meats, and vegetables, forming the basis of many comforting and flavourful meals that reflect the authentic tastes of Northern Germany.

When seeking out these culinary delights, exploring the charming towns and villages scattered throughout Friesland is key. Coastal areas like Wangerland and Wangerooge are prime spots for fresh seafood restaurants, often offering stunning sea views alongside your meal. Inland towns such as Zetel and Varel provide access to traditional inns and local eateries where you can sample regional specialties and enjoy a more laid-back dining experience. For Muslim travellers, finding Halal-certified restaurants might require some research, as options can be limited outside major cities; however, many establishments are accommodating and can prepare dishes without pork or with careful attention to ingredients upon request.

The cost of dining in Friesland offers excellent value for international travellers. A hearty meal at a local Gasthaus or a casual restaurant can range from approximately ₱700 to ₱1,500 per person, providing a substantial and satisfying experience. For those seeking a more upscale dining experience, particularly in areas known for their culinary offerings, prices might range from ₱2,000 to ₱4,000 per person. These prices are generally lower than what many travellers from the US, Europe, or India might expect in comparable establishments in their home countries, making Friesland an attractive destination for food enthusiasts on a budget.

Navigating dining etiquette in Friesland is straightforward and generally aligns with common European customs. Tipping is customary but not mandatory; a small gratuity of around 5-10% for good service is appreciated and can be left in cash. Meal times tend to follow a typical German schedule, with lunch being the main meal of the day, often served between 12 PM and 2 PM, and dinner usually taken between 6 PM and 8 PM. It's polite to wait to be seated in restaurants, and making reservations, especially for dinner on weekends, is advisable to secure a table.

Cultural Norms and Staying Safe in Friesland

Understanding local customs is key to a smooth and respectful visit to Friesland. Germans, in general, value punctuality and order, so arriving on time for appointments or reservations is highly regarded. While tourist areas are accustomed to international visitors, in smaller villages, a polite greeting like "Guten Tag" (Good day) when entering shops or interacting with locals is appreciated. Personal space is generally respected, and directness in communication is common, which might be perceived as blunt by some cultures but is typically not intended to be rude.

When visiting Friesland's attractions, such as its coastal areas or historical sites, dress codes are usually casual, though modest attire is recommended for any churches or more formal settings. Photography is generally permitted in public spaces, but it's always courteous to ask for permission before taking close-up photos of individuals. Queuing is orderly, and respecting the line is expected. Entry etiquette for homes or private gatherings, if invited, typically involves bringing a small gift, such as flowers or chocolates, for the host.

Friesland is a safe region for international travellers, with low crime rates. However, as with any travel, it's wise to take standard precautions. Keep valuables secure and be aware of your surroundings, especially in more crowded tourist spots. For transportation, reliable public transport options, including buses and trains, are available. Ride-hailing apps like Uber may have limited availability in smaller towns, so familiarizing yourself with local taxi services or using public transport is recommended. Offline map applications can be invaluable for navigating the region.

In case of emergencies in Friesland, dial 112 for police, ambulance, or fire services. For specific concerns, local police stations are available. While there isn't a Philippine Embassy in Friesland itself, the Philippine Embassy in Berlin is the primary diplomatic mission for Filipinos in Germany. It's advisable to register your travel with the embassy or the Overseas Workers Welfare Administration (OWWA) if applicable. Carrying travel insurance is highly recommended for all travellers, especially Filipino passport holders, to cover any unforeseen medical expenses or emergencies.

Getting to Friesland and Getting Around

Reaching Friesland from the Philippines involves a journey that typically requires at least one connecting flight. Travellers departing from Manila (MNL), Cebu (CEB), or other major Philippine hubs will find flights to major German airports like Hamburg (HAM) or Bremen (BRE), which serve as gateways to the Friesland region. The total flight duration can range from 15 to over 20 hours, depending on the layovers. While direct flights are uncommon, numerous airlines offer routes with convenient connections. Booking your book flight in advance can secure better fares, often starting from around ₱40,000 to ₱60,000 for a round trip. From the arrival airport, onward travel to Friesland can be via train or rental car.

Once you arrive in Germany, getting to Friesland is most efficiently done by train. Major German cities are well-connected by Deutsche Bahn (DB), and you can take a train from Hamburg or Bremen towards stations within Friesland, such as Varel or Sande. The journey offers scenic views of the German countryside. Within Friesland itself, public transportation consists mainly of local buses and regional trains, which are generally reliable and connect the various towns and villages. For exploring more remote areas or enjoying the coastal paths, renting a car or utilizing bicycle rentals, widely available in many towns, are excellent options.

The best time to visit Friesland largely depends on your preferences for weather and activities. The summer months, from June to August, offer the warmest temperatures and longest daylight hours, making it ideal for enjoying the beaches and outdoor pursuits. This is also peak tourist season, so expect larger crowds and potentially higher accommodation prices. Sp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) provide milder weather, fewer tourists, and beautiful scenery, with autumn colours adding a special charm. Winter offers a quieter, more introspective experience, with fewer visitors and a chance to enjoy the dramatic coastal landscapes in a different light.

Before embarking on your trip to Friesland, a few pre-departure preparations are essential. The local currency is the Euro (EUR), and while credit cards are widely accepted in hotels, restaurants, and larger shops, carrying some cash for smaller purchases or in more rural areas is advisable. Consider purchasing a local SIM card upon arrival at the airport for affordable data and calls, or check your roaming options. Essential apps include Google Maps for navigation, a translation app for basic German phrases, and potentially a local public transport app. Ensure your passport has at least six months of validity beyond your intended stay.

Visa Information

For Philippine passport holders planning to visit Friesland, Germany, it is crucial to understand the visa requirements for entering the Schengen Area, of which Germany is a part. As of current regulations, Philippine citizens require a Schengen visa to enter Germany for tourism or short stays. This visa allows you to travel freely within the Schengen zone for up to 90 days within any 180-day period. The application process involves submitting a detailed application form, a valid passport with at least six months of remaining validity, proof of accommodation, flight reservations, travel insurance, and financial means to support your stay.

The application for a Schengen visa must be submitted to the German Embassy or Consulate in the Philippines, or through their designated visa application centre (e.g., VFS Global). It is recommended to apply at least 45 days before your intended travel date, as processing times can vary. Required documents typically include passport-sized photos, a cover letter explaining the purpose of your visit, proof of employment or student status, and a detailed itinerary. The visa fee is approximately ₱5,000, though this can change. It is essential to have proof of onward travel, such as return flight tickets and confirmed hotel bookings in Friesland or other parts of Germany.

Visa policies and requirements are subject to change, and it is imperative for all travellers to verify the latest information directly with the official sources. Before booking flights or making non-refundable arrangements, it is highly recommended to confirm your visa status and understand all entry requirements with the German Embassy or Consulate in the Philippines. This proactive approach will ensure a smoother travel experience and prevent any last-minute complications for your journey to Friesland.
